Since 1984, CIMEA - Information Center on Academic Mobility and Equivalence has been engaged in the field of information and consulting services relating to the procedures for the recognition of academic qualifications and to issues relating to Italian and international higher education and training.
CIMEA is the official Italian center within the NARIC - National Academic Recognition Information Centres – network of the European Union and the ENIC - European National Information Centres – network of the European Council and of UNESCO.
CIMEA supports academic mobility in all its forms and facilitates the understanding of the components of the Italian and foreign higher education and training systems and promotes the principles of the Lisbon Convention in the field of academic qualification recognition.
CIMEA launched one of the first uses of Blockchain technology applied to Academic Credential Evaluation with the Diplome digital platform. For more information and a deeper analysis of the project refer to the Diplome White Paper.
